Apache maven
Soumyakanti Ray is a writer, blogger, and SEO analyst with over nine years of experience.
As stewards of Central for nearly 20 years and inventors of both software supply chain management and Nexus Repository, Sonatype knows that the integrity of your build is critical. Cache, publish, and distribute components with your teams. Add enterprise features as your needs evolve. Protect your repositories from malicious components, evaluate component risk and dependencies in-app, and enable development teams by tying your repository manager into the Sonatype Platform. Find OSS Components As stewards of Central for nearly 20 years and inventors of both software supply chain management and Nexus Repository, Sonatype knows that the integrity of your build is critical.
Apache maven
Apache Maven is a software project management and comprehension tool. Based on the concept of a project object model POM , Maven can manage a project's build, reporting and documentation from a central piece of information. If you think you have found a bug, please file an issue in the Maven Issue Tracker. More information can be found on Apache Maven Homepage. Questions related to the usage of Maven should be posted on the Maven User List. You can download the release source from our download page. Take a look into the contribution guidelines. This code is under the Apache License, Version 2. Do you like Apache Maven? Then donate back to the ASF to support the development. Skip to content. You signed in with another tab or window. Reload to refresh your session.
Used in projects.
Maven is a powerful project management tool that is based on POM project object model. It is used for project build, dependency, and documentation. It simplifies the build process like ANT. But it is too much more advanced than ANT. In short terms we can tell maven is a tool that can be used for building and managing any Java-based project. Maven is mostly used for the java projects to build web application packages.
Maven is distributed in several formats for your convenience. Simply pick a ready-made binary distribution archive and follow the installation instructions. Use a source archive if you intend to build Maven yourself. It is strongly recommended to use the latest release version of Apache Maven to take advantage of newest features and bug fixes. If you still want to use an old version, you can find more information in the Maven Releases History and can download files from the Maven 3 archives for versions 3. Maven 4. Downloading Apache Maven 3. It still allows you to build against 1. In addition to that, disk space will be used for your local Maven repository. The size of your local repository will vary depending on usage but expect at least MB.
Apache maven
Maven, a Yiddish word meaning accumulator of knowledge , began as an attempt to simplify the build processes in the Jakarta Turbine project. There were several projects, each with their own Ant build files, that were all slightly different. We wanted a standard way to build the projects, a clear definition of what the project consisted of, an easy way to publish project information, and a way to share JARs across several projects. The result is a tool that can now be used for building and managing any Java-based project.
Headrush clothing
View More. This is clearly undesirable, so cleaning has been given its own lifecycle. Larger projects should be divided into several modules, or sub-projects, each with its own POM. What is Microsoft Azure Functions? Additional Information. Maven is an most powerful tool to build the artifacts of the java projects by usin the POM. It can be a great opportunity to meet them. About Apache Maven core maven. Plugins are the primary way to extend Maven. Take a look into the contribution guidelines.
This guide is intended as a reference for those working with Maven for the first time, but is also intended to serve as a cookbook with self-contained references and solutions for common use cases. For first time users, it is recommended that you step through the material in a sequential fashion. For users more familiar with Maven, this guide endeavours to provide a quick solution for the need at hand.
Data Transport. This includes an in-depth description of what Maven is and a list of some of its main features. Folders and files Name Name Last commit message. He loves to play cricket, football, and video games in his free time. Open In App. Maven also has standard phases for cleaning the project and for generating a project site. How to Get Support Support for Maven is available in a variety of different forms. Developer Tools. Maven is a powerful project management tool that is based on POM project object model. Build tool. Blog Know more about remote work.
I think, that you are not right. I am assured. Let's discuss. Write to me in PM, we will talk.